Abstract:
The present application relates to compositions comprising selenium compounds, such as 5′-Methylselenoadenosine, Se-Adenosyl-L-homocysteine, Gamma-glutamyl-methylseleno-cysteine, a compound of formula (I), formula (II), a compound of formula (III) and combinations thereof, and methods of using the same in enhancing mitochondrial function, or treating mitochondrial dysfunction.

Abstract:
The present application relates to compositions comprising selenium compounds, such as 5′-Methylselenoadenosine, a compound of Formula (I), and combinations thereof, and methods of using the same for inhibiting β amyloid aggregation, ApoE4 expression, p38 or Tau protein phosphorylation, or increasing Neprilysin and Insulin Degrading Enzyme expression.

Abstract:
The present application relates to compositions comprising selenium compounds, such as 5′-Methylselenoadenosine, Se-Adenosyl-L-homocysteine, Gamma-glutamyl-methylseleno-cysteine, a compound of Formula (I), Formula (II), or Formula (III), and combinations thereof, and methods of using the same for modulating glucose metabolism in a subject.
